Abingdon School is seeking a Cleaning Supervisor to join their team in Abingdon, overseeing cleanliness across various facilities. This part-time position, requiring 15 hours a week, involves supervising staff, managing cleaning schedules, and ensuring high standards of cleanliness.
Ideal candidates should possess:
- Strong attention to detail
- Effective communication skills
- A commitment to health and safety
Additionally, the role offers various benefits, including a pro-rated annual leave, pension schemes, and access to fitness facilities.

How to prepare for a job interview at Abingdon School
✨Know the Role Inside Out
Before your interview, make sure you thoroughly understand the responsibilities of a Cleaning Supervisor. Familiarise yourself with the specific cleaning standards and health and safety regulations that Abingdon School adheres to. This will show your commitment and readiness to take on the role.
✨Showcase Your Leadership Skills
As a Cleaning Supervisor, you'll be overseeing staff and managing schedules. Prepare examples from your past experiences where you've successfully led a team or improved processes. Highlight your communication skills and how you motivate others to maintain high cleanliness standards.
✨Prepare Questions About the Team
Interviews are a two-way street! Think of insightful questions to ask about the cleaning team and their current challenges. This not only shows your interest in the position but also helps you gauge if the environment is the right fit for you.
